When there is an issue with your home's foundation, you might be on one hand concerned about the short-term monetary cost of repairs, and on the other about the long-term cost of delaying them. Homes in an area that gets high temperatures (such as West Perrine) are at increased risk of foundation problems. Excess heat can dry out and loosen the soil that holds a foundation in place, and can even damage the foundation itself.

Waterproofing goes a long way towards reducing the risk of future problems with your foundation. The total amount you will pay for basement or foundation waterproofing in West Perrine will vary greatly depending on what sort of waterproofing is needed. Some fixes are simple, like rerouting a gutter system, but in other cases more extensive interior or exterior waterproofing will be necessary. Interior waterproofing can involve things like the use of sump pumps or installation of drains. Exterior waterproofing will likely be more expensive (sometimes above $10,000, depending on the extent of repairs required) and can involve coating the outside of your foundation or altering your landscaping. Not all foundation repair companies do waterproofing — check whether your company works with a waterproofing contractor who can assess, identify, and resolve any issues.

If you are constructing a new home or an extension on your current home, you can get a soil report beforehand. This will let you know whether the soil in a specific location can support a structure without leading to sinking or shifting. For your current home, you can pay a structural engineer (usually a few hundred dollars) to perform an inspection and determine if there are any signs of deterioration or damage to your foundation. During the hot summers in West Perrine, you might need to water your foundation. This keeps the soil around it from drying out, crumbling, and possibly shifting your foundation. (You may not actually need to do this too often in West Perrine, which can see a good amount of rain.) However, make sure to avoid overwatering your foundation, as having excess moisture can cause as many problems as not having enough.

Home insurance does not usually cover foundation repairs. When repairs are covered, it is usually because the damage was caused by a covered weather event such as a hurricane. We recommend speaking with someone from your home insurance company to make sure.
